Review summary

This was only our third Norwegian cruise and we are looking forward to taking another voyage on this ship. We have cruised over twenty years and truly enjoy a well run ship with a good food selection and a great staff.

Embarkation

1 out of 5
LA port is a mess. The Joy crew had their hands full with the poor dock facilities. The crew had to overcome the lack of dock space for cargo loading and passenger embarkation. To exacerbate the situation the HAL website stated the incorrect ship location.

Ship experiences

Food and Dining

5 out of 5
The Garden Cafe was the best we have experienced on many cruise lines, as our fellow cruisers discovered. The Cafe always had a good selection of food, and was especially crowded during breakfast and lunch. Cagney's Steakhouse was the best.

Onboard Activities

3 out of 5
We had visited most of the activity areas but did not spend much time enjoying the facilities.

Entertainment

4 out of 5
We enjoyed the musicians in various locations. The Brewhouse musician was very enjoyable.

Service and Staff

5 out of 5
The entire crew was very busy, but always had time to be very cordial. The highlight for many of the guests was Rowen ("tambourine man") who always had a smile and a song when you entered the Garden Cafe. The general manager and his assistant Abegail Lego seemed to be everywhere helping the staff and guests.

Ship Quality

5 out of 5
The crew, waiters, cabin attendants, and supervisors all helped in maintaining clean common areas and dining areas. It was not uncommon to see the supervisors helping the staff in the Garden Cafe.

Cabin / Stateroom

4 out of 5
The cabin was very comfortable and had more storage then most ships. The only reason for only 4 stars was the cabin was above the bow thrusters and would vibrate during docking operations which, some mornings, started very early.

Ship tip

The most comfortable and scenic place on the ship is the Observation area on deck 15.
